History of Paris and its Monuments by Eugène de la Gourmerie - Alfred Mame & Fils, Editors, Tours 1880 - Fourth edition including the latest events and new monuments -
History of Paris through its emblematic monuments and exploration of the architectural and cultural heritage of the city - Paris at the different ages of its history - Critical and anecdotal history of the monuments of Paris, etc. -
Publisher's full burgundy cloth binding with gilt title and a wide decorative composition on the upper cover depicting the arms of Paris crowned and surrounded by a laurel wreath, with the motto 'Fluctuat nec Mergitur', smooth spine gilt, all edges gilt, rear board bordered by black fillets with a central medallion bearing the editor's name and adorned with a tower, 420 pages, format in-4° (22 x 30 cm) - Richly illustrated with a frontispiece, steel engravings on guard and a very large number of wood engravings in text and on plates in black and white - Table of contents: see photos -
Good condition, however the guards and pastedowns are worn
